Staff Requests

I like hiring/managing my staff. I would love to see some changes to staff in OOTP15.

1. Don't create new mangers/coaches/trainers/scouts/gm's with experience. If they are new they should be at 0 years. I like to look at stats if they have experience. If they have 5 years experience I should see five years of stats.

2. Place a significant weight on experience and winning percentage for salary requests and demand. ( I think this is done already which is why I hate a new coach, with no stats to look at, is generated with 30 years experience )

3. Don't allow Trainers to be hired as managers, I would much rather see the position unfilled on a AI controlled team and no stat generated than see a trainer with a winning record as a manager

4. If a team vacates a minor league manager position, a suitable hitting/pitching coach moves into the role from that same team; or from another minor affiliate to fill the vacant positions before they hire outside the franchise.

5. If the Major League team lets someone go, then sometimes promote from within. OOTP always hires from outside, and sometimes on AI teams their best rated coach is teaching hitting in AA. It can happen in real life but not always.

#3 only happens if the pool of managers/hitting coaches/pitching coaches is very low
Think of it like cats, for every team you need 2 to 3 available staff

I usually get in trouble in historical sims with trainers. I forget about them since I make them from the hometown and give them a 10 yr contract, then they retire early, so I get managers and scouts as the worse trainers ever

#4 I think this was brought up as a suggestion for 13 and the response was something along the lines that the AI cannot think along that line as they are pretty much coded as MGR/PC/HC

I'd like the AI to stop making fictional coaches though w/o telling you who they created which goes along your line of #1 I try to see who is new, but sorting by experience doesn't give me everyone and when old players are created at the end of the regular season there name pops up quick and if you have more than 4 names, it's a pain tracking them down and changing them from BC to MGR or PC/HC
